Choosing the Right Gel Insoles for Work Boots

Gel insoles can drastically improve comfort and reduce fatigue when you’re on your feet all day, especially in work boots. But with so many options available, selecting the best pair requires considering a few key features. Here’s a breakdown to help you make the right choice.

Shock Absorption: The Foundation of Comfort

Perhaps the most important feature is shock absorption. Work boots are often worn on hard surfaces, and repeated impact can lead to foot, leg, and back pain. Insoles with robust shock absorption, often utilizing gel or foam technologies (like PORON or memory foam), significantly reduce this impact. Look for insoles specifically marketed for high-impact activities or those with multi-layer cushioning systems. The more cushioning, generally, the better the shock protection – but this can sometimes come at the expense of stability. Consider your work environment; if you’re on concrete all day, prioritize maximum shock absorption.

Arch Support: Alignment and Stability

Arch support is crucial for maintaining proper foot alignment and preventing issues like plantar fasciitis. Insoles come with varying levels of arch support – low, medium, or high. Most work boot insoles cater to low to medium arches, as high arch support can feel uncomfortable in a work boot environment. If you have flat feet, prioritize an insole with arch support to help distribute your weight more evenly. Conversely, if you have very high arches, you might need a specialized insole or consult a podiatrist. Adequate arch support reduces strain on your feet, ankles, and knees.

Material & Durability: Long-Lasting Support

The materials used in gel insoles affect both comfort and longevity. EVA foam provides a good balance of cushioning and support, while gel offers superior shock absorption. Look for insoles with a durable top layer (fabric or moisture-wicking material) to prevent wear and tear, and a robust base layer to maintain shape. Some insoles suggest rotating between two pairs to extend their lifespan, as the cushioning can compress over time. Consider the overall construction – multi-layer designs tend to be more durable and offer better performance.

Fit & Trim-to-Fit Options

Proper fit is essential. Many gel insoles are designed to be trimmed to fit your specific shoe size. Always remove your boot’s existing insole before measuring and trimming the new one. Pay attention to sizing charts provided by the manufacturer. A well-fitting insole will stay in place and provide consistent support. If you’re between sizes, it’s generally better to size up and trim down.

Additional Features: Breathability & Odor Control

Beyond the core features, consider breathability and odor control. Moisture-wicking fabrics and ventilated designs help keep your feet cool and dry, reducing the risk of blisters and odor. Some insoles incorporate technologies like Polygiene to actively fight odor-causing bacteria. These features are especially important if you work in hot or humid conditions.
